Note:
A number of photographs of coaches are in other categories, mainly officials and fights.

Some examples of photographs put in the “Other” category in Table 1: the three photographs of Florence Joiner meditating in figure 23; some sports action photographs of such non-conventional sports as karate; two photographs by different photographers of Nancy Reagan being lifted by basketball players; and Jesse Jackson baptising Mike Tyson. Of the 1521 entries, 251 have females in the photograph either alone or with other females or males.
